Jak korzystać z narzędzia Excel do tworzenia planszy
Naucz się korzystać z narzędzia Excel do tworzenia tablic.
Pobierz narzędzie Excel do tworzenia tablic
Pobierz plik z poniższego linku i wyodrębnij pliki z pliku ZIP.
Utworzenie parametrów układu planszy
Aby zdefiniować układ i parametry płyty, musisz edytować ją w Excelu i zapisać jako plik .xlsx. Możesz stworzyć go od podstaw lub edytować na podstawie pliku, który dystrybuujesz jako próbkę.
Może to być dowolna nazwa pliku, ale może też być nazwą pliku ostatecznej definicji kontenera na płytze wyjściowej.
Parametry kontenera płyty
Aby stworzyć parametry kontenera na tablicy, stwórz arkusz kontenera. Ta przeprawa musi zostać zrobiona.
Stwórz nagłówki dla pierwszej kolumny "Key" oraz drugiej kolumny "Value" w pierwszym wierszu.
W kolumnie Klucz wpisz wyróżniającą nazwę identyfikującą wartość, a następnie wpisz każdą wartość w kolumnie Wartości. Parametry, które można określić, to:
- IdentityName
- Autor
- Wersja
- ISWYŁĄCZYNASTĘPNY BOARD
- Zamówienie
- KeyReleaseTimingWhenActiveWindowChange
- Uwagi
Aby uzyskać więcej informacji o każdym parametrze, prosimy odnaleźć się w linku do definicji pliku poniżej.
Poniżej znajdziesz informacje o tworzeniu narzędzia Excel oraz jego ustawieniach.
| Kluczowe | uwagi |
|---|---|
| IdentityName | Ten parametr jest obowiązkowy. |
| GeneratorIdentityName | Jest ustawiony automatycznie. |
| GeneratorVersion | Jest ustawiony automatycznie. |
Parametry planszy
Aby stworzyć parametry dla tablicy, stwórz arkusz Board. Ta przeprawa musi zostać zrobiona.
W pierwszym wierszu wpisz wyróżniającą nazwę parametrów planszy.
Od drugiej linii wprowadzaj tablicę przez kilka minut, aby dopasować parametry z nagłówka.
Parametry, które można określić dla kolumny, to:
- IdentityName
- Pozycja
- StartPozycjaTyp
- PozycjaPrzesunięcie
- NextBoardPositionType
- Pozycja środkowa
- FontSizeScale
- BoardScale
- ImageName
- ImageStretchMode
Aby uzyskać więcej informacji o każdym parametrze, prosimy odnaleźć się w linku do definicji pliku poniżej.
Poniżej znajdziesz informacje o tworzeniu narzędzia Excel oraz jego ustawieniach.
| Kluczowe | uwagi |
|---|---|
| Pozycja | Zazwyczaj wpisujesz tutaj rozmiar planszy, ale jeśli tego nie robisz, automatycznie określa ją do układu klawiszy. Jednakże, ponieważ pozycja wyświetlacza będzie (0, 0), pozycja wyświetlacza musi być określona z parametrami StartPositionType i PositionOffset. Dla każdego parametru wpisz "X, Y, Width, Height" oddzielone przecinkami. |
| PozycjaPrzesunięcie | Dla każdego parametru wpisz "X, Y" oddzielone przecinkami. |
| Pozycja środkowa | Dla każdego parametru wpisz "X, Y" oddzielone przecinkami. |
Układ klawiszy
Aby stworzyć układ klawiszy, stwórz arkusz {X}_Layout. W części "{X}" określ indeks planszy zaczynając od 1. Jeśli chcesz wyświetlić więcej niż jedną tablicę, będziesz potrzebować tej kartki tylu planszy, ile chcesz.
W tym arkuszu wstawisz kształty, aby stworzyć układ klawiszy. Możesz umieścić dowolny kształt, ale obecnie możesz stworzyć tylko prostokątny klawisz, więc zalecamy użycie prostokątnego kształtu.
Po umieszczeniu kształtu wpisz kluczową nazwę wyróżnioną wewnątrz kształtu. Ta wyróżniająca nazwa jest związana z parametrem klucza. Należy zauważyć, że to nie tekst pojawia się na kluczu.
Jeśli wpiszesz nazwę identyfikacyjną, która nie istnieje w parametrze klucza, tekst zostanie ustawiony na "KeyType" lub "DisplayText" parametru klucza. Prosimy pamiętać, że jeśli podano nieistniejący "KeyType", aplikacja nie będzie mogła go załadować.
Podczas umieszczania kształtów rozmiar komórek za nimi nie wpływa na wynik.
Kluczowe parametry
Aby utworzyć kluczowe parametry, stwórz arkusz {X}_KeyDefine. W części "{X}" określ indeks planszy zaczynając od 1. Ten arkusz jest zestawiony z {X}_Layout. Jeśli chcesz wyświetlić więcej niż jedną tablicę, będziesz potrzebować tej kartki tylu planszy, ile chcesz.
W pierwszej linii wpisz wyróżniającą nazwę parametru klucza.
Od drugiej linii wpisz liczbę kluczy wyświetlanych na planszy docelowej zgodnie z parametrami w nagłówku dla każdej linii.
Parametry, które można określić dla kolumny, to:
- Nazwa
- KeyType
- Pozycja
- DisplayText
- FontSize
- ImageName
- ImageStretchMode
- IsToggle
- IsOneClickToggleRelease
- Opcje
- Procesy
Aby uzyskać więcej informacji o każdym parametrze, prosimy odnaleźć się w linku do definicji pliku poniżej.
Poniżej znajdziesz informacje o tworzeniu narzędzia Excel oraz jego ustawieniach.
| Kluczowe | uwagi |
|---|---|
| Nazwa | Nazwa wpisana tutaj jest powiązana z nazwą wpisaną w kształcie arkusza układu, a wprowadzony parametr klucza jest przypisany do klucza w docelowej pozycji. Wyjście do pliku definicji kontenera board opiera się na arkuszu układu, więc nie ma znaczenia, czy wpisana tutaj nazwa nie znajduje się w arkuszu układu. |
| KeyType | Jeśli nie, używana jest wartość wpisana w kolumnie Nazwa. |
| Pozycja | Jeśli wpiszesz pozycję i rozmiar tutaj, zostaną one użyte jako pierwsze, ale zazwyczaj użyjesz pozycji i rozmiaru ustawionych w arkuszu z układem klucza, więc zasadniczo możesz zostawić je bez wpisania. Jeśli chcesz wejść, wpisz "X, Y, Szerokość, Wysokość" oddzielone przecinkami. Jednostka to piksel logiczny. |
| DisplayText | Poprzez podzielenie tekstu w komórce, faktyczny tekst wyświetlany również zostaje uszkodzony. |
| Opcje | Jeśli chcesz go użyć, wprowadź go zgodnie z formatem. |
| Procesy | Jeśli chcesz go użyć, wprowadź go zgodnie z formatem. |
Dekoracja planszowa
Możesz ustawić szczegółowe dekoracje dla wyglądu planszy.
W pierwszym wierszu wpisz wyróżniającą nazwę parametrów dekoracji planszy. Od drugiej linii będziemy ustalać dekorację planszy dla każdej planszy i warunków.
Możesz określić, do których komisji aplikować, wpisując IdentyfikatorName określone w arkuszu Boards dla TargetBoardName.
Możesz też określić, kiedy należy zastosować IME dla "ImeStatuses" i który klawisz użyć przy naciśnięciu "PressKeys".
Parametry, które można określić dla kolumny, to:
- IdentityName
- TargetBoardName
- ImeStatuses
- PressKeys
- Kolor tła
- ImageName
- ImageStretchMode
- BorderColor
- Grubość Bordera
Aby uzyskać więcej informacji o każdym parametrze, prosimy odnaleźć się w linku do definicji pliku poniżej.
Poniżej znajdziesz informacje o tworzeniu narzędzia Excel oraz jego ustawieniach.
| Kluczowe | uwagi |
|---|---|
| TargetBoardName | Określ, do których komisji chcesz, aby to dotyczyło. Nazwa, którą podajesz, to IdentityName podana w arkuszu Board. |
| ImeStatuses | Określa, kiedy aktualnie znajduje się IME, w którym dekoracja jest nałożona. Aby uzyskać informacje o tym, które wartości można określić, zobacz Defining BoardDecorateInfo. Jeśli chcesz wpisać więcej niż jeden, wpisz go oddzielonego przecinkami. (np. KanaInputAlphaHalf, KanaInputKatakanaHalf) |
| PressKeys | Określ, które klawisze dodają dekoracje podczas naciskania. Na przykład, jeśli wybierzesz LeftShift, dekoracja zostanie nałożona po naciśnięciu klawisza Shift. Jeśli chcesz użyć kilku kluczy jednocześnie, określ wiele z przecinkami. |
| Kolor tła | Określ kolor od 0~255. Wpisz wartości jako "A,R,G,B" oddzielone przecinkami. |
| BorderColor | Określ kolor od 0~255. Wpisz wartości jako "A,R,G,B" oddzielone przecinkami. |
Dekoracja klucza
Możesz ustawić szczegółowe dekoracje dotyczące wyglądu kluczy.
W pierwszym wierszu wpisz wyróżniającą nazwę parametru odznaczenia klucza. Od drugiej linii będziemy ustawiać ozdobę klucza dla każdego klucza i warunku celu.
Możesz określić, do którego klawisza należy zastosować zadanie, wpisując "Nazwę" podaną w arkuszu "{X}_KeyDefine" w "TargetBoardName".
Możesz też określić, kiedy IME jest stosowane do "ImeStatuses", który klawisz jest używany podczas naciskania i "IsPressed", który klawisz jest naciśnięty.
Parametry, które można określić dla kolumny, to:
- IdentityName
- TargetKeyName
- ImeStatuses
- PressKeys
- IsPressed
- DisplayText
- FontName
- FontSize
- TextBold
- TextColor
- Kolor tła
- ImageName
- ImageStretchMode
- BorderColor
- Grubość Bordera
Aby uzyskać więcej informacji o każdym parametrze, prosimy odnaleźć się w linku do definicji pliku poniżej.
Poniżej znajdziesz informacje o tworzeniu narzędzia Excel oraz jego ustawieniach.
| Kluczowe | uwagi |
|---|---|
| TargetKeyName | Określ, do którego klucza chcesz, żeby to dotyczyło. Nazwa, którą należy podać, to "Nazwa" podana w arkuszu "{X}_KeyDefine". |
| ImeStatuses | Określa, kiedy aktualnie znajduje się IME, w którym dekoracja jest nałożona. Zobacz Defining KeyDecorateInfo, dla których można określić wartości. Jeśli chcesz wpisać więcej niż jeden, wpisz go oddzielonego przecinkami. (np. KanaInputAlphaHalf, KanaInputKatakanaHalf) |
| PressKeys | Określa, który z pozostałych klawiszy nałoży dekorację podczas naciskania. Na przykład, jeśli wybierzesz LeftShift, dekoracja zostanie nałożona po naciśnięciu klawisza Shift. Jeśli chcesz użyć kilku kluczy jednocześnie, określ wiele z przecinkami. Możesz także dołączyć swój własny klucz do warunku. |
| IsPressed | PRAWDA. Dodaj dekoracje, gdy naciskasz klawisz. FAŁSZYWE lub nieokreślone, to zwykłe ozdobenie klucza. |
| TextColor | Określ kolor od 0~255. Wpisz wartości jako "A,R,G,B" oddzielone przecinkami. |
| Kolor tła | Określ kolor od 0~255. Wpisz wartości jako "A,R,G,B" oddzielone przecinkami. |
| BorderColor | Określ kolor od 0~255. Wpisz wartości jako "A,R,G,B" oddzielone przecinkami. |
Tworzenie pliku definicji kontenera płytowego
Powstanie
Przenieś utworzony plik definicji płyty (.xlsx) do folderu z plikiem "BoardCreator_x_xx.xlsm". (x_xx jest wersją)
Po przeniesieniu pliku otwórz BoardCreator.xlsm. Klikając przycisk "Generate Board Container Definition File" wyświetlany na arkuszu, generowany jest plik definicji kontenera board na podstawie .xlsx pliku umieszczonego w folderze.
Gdy proces zostanie pomyślnie zakończony, zobaczysz ". Tworzony jest "plik definicji kontenera na tablicy" z rozszerzeniem "setting".
Bezpieczeństwo
Ponieważ "BoardCreator.xlsm" to plik Excel zawierający makra, możesz otrzymać ostrzeżenie po jego otwarciu, jak pokazano na obrazku. (Przekaz może różnić się od rysunku)
Jeśli zobaczysz ostrzeżenie, pozwól na uruchomienie makra. Jeśli tego nie umożliwisz, nie będziesz mógł stworzyć "pliku definicji kontenera na desce".
Umieszczanie pliku definicji kontenera na płytce
Umieść plik definicji utworzonego kontenera board (.setting) w folderze "Boards\Default\" w folderze z "TiitanTouchBoard.exe". Po założeniu płyta dotykowa zostanie załadowana podczas uruchamiania.
Jeśli podasz błędne parametry, możesz uzyskać błąd podczas wykonania, więc proszę przejrzyj ustawienia płyty docelowej i odtworz ją.
O przykładowych planszach dołączonych
Aby ułatwić tworzenie planszy dla osób po raz pierwszy, narzędzie Board Creation Excel zawiera przykładową tablicę, która jest mała dla każdej funkcji oryginalnego pakietu planszy. Dołączone próbki to:
| Obraz | podsumowania | nazwy pliku |
|---|---|---|
| 010_Normal_1_03_Ja | To klawiatura z domyślnym układem normalnym. | |
| 020_Thumb_1_03_Ja | Jest to klawiatura z układem kciuka, która jest dołączona w domyślnym stanie. | |
| 030_MousePad_1_03_Ja | Jest to podkładka pod mysz, która jest dołączona w stanie początkowym. | |
| 031_MousePadOneHandLeft_1_03_Ja | To jest podkładka pod mysz po lewej stronie, dołączona do pakietu płyty. | |
| 032_MousePadOneHandRight_1_03_Ja | To jest podkładka pod mysz po prawej stronie, dołączona do pakietu deski. | |
| 033_MousePadExtensionKey_1_03_Ja | Jest to rozszerzona podkładka pod mysz dołączona do pakietu płyty. | |
| 040_TenKeyLeft_1_03_Ja | Jest to leworęczna klawiatura numeryczna dołączona do pakietu płyty. | |
| 041_TenKeyRight_1_03_Ja | Jest to klawiatura numeryczna po prawej stronie, dołączona do pakietu płyty. | |
| 042_TenKeyLeftNumLock_1_03_Ja | Jest to lewosręczna klawiatura numeryczna NumLock, dołączona do pakietu płyty. | |
| 043_TenKeyRightNumLock_1_03_Ja | To jest klawiatura numeryczna do prawego NumLocka dołączonego do pakietu płyty. | |
| 050_GameController_1_03_Ja | To kontroler do gry dołączony do pakietu planszy. | |
| 060_IllustCspLeft_1_03_Ja | To jest leworęczna klawiatura skrótowa Clip Studio Paint dołączona do pakietu płyty. | |
| 061_IllustCspRight_1_03_Ja | To jest klawiatura skrótowa dla prawej ręki Clip Studio Paint, która jest dołączona do pakietu płyty. | |
| 062_IllustPsLeft_1_03_Ja | To jest lewosęczna deska skrótów Photshop dołączona do pakietu deski. | |
| 063_IllustPsRight_1_03_Ja | To jest prawoskrętna klawiatura Photshop, dołączona do pakietu deski. | |
| 501_MinimumBoardSample_1_03_Ja | Jest to tablica próbkowa stworzona w najmniejszej możliwej konfiguracji. | |
| 502_FourBoardsSample_1_03_Ja | To jest plansza próbna z czterema planszami umieszczonymi w czterech narożnikach. | |
| 503_BoardPositionSample_1_03_Ja | Plansza próbna z tablicą w dowolnym miejscu i rozmiarze. | |
| 504_BoardPositionOffsetSample_1_03_Ja | To jest plansza próbkowa z przesuniętą z pozycji początkowej. | |
| 505_BoardScaleSample_1_03_Ja | Jest to próbka płyty z powiększoną wersją całego tekstu i klawiszy. | |
| 506_BoardImageSample_1_03_Ja | To jest przykładowa tablica z obrazkiem na tle planszy. | |
| 511_ImeOnOffDecorateSample_1_03_Ja | To jest przykład dekoracji do płyt przełączających według IME, włączania i wyłączania. | |
| 512_ImeDetailDecorateSample_1_03_Ja | To jest przykład dekoracji planszowych przełączników zgodnie ze szczegółowymi specyfikacjami, takimi jak IME wejście kana i rzymskie znaki rzymskie. Zmiana kolorów dla każdego IME pomoże Ci zrozumieć aktualny status IME. | |
| 513_PressKeyBoardDecorateSample_1_03_Ja | To przykład zmiany dekoracji planszy w zależności od stanu naciśniętego klawisza. Naciśnij klawisz Shift lub Ctrl, aby zmienić tło płyty. | |
| 514_TransparentColorBoardSample_1_03_Ja | Jest to próbka, która przesyła tło płyty. Pozwala to także stworzyć planszę, w której unoszą się tylko klawisze. | |
| 515_TransparentImageBoardSample_1_03_Ja | Próbka planszy wykonanej w dowolnym kształcie z przezroczystym obrazem na tle planszy. Możesz także stworzyć planszę w swobodnej formie, używając przyciętego obrazu kluczowego tła. | |
| 521_KeySimpleDecorateSample_1_03_Ja | To jest próbka z standardowymi ozdobami nałożonymi na klawisze. Możesz określić "tekst klucza", "rozmiar czcionki", "kolor tła" itd. | |
| 522_KeyToggleSample_1_03_Ja | To przykład sprawdzania zachowania przełącznika różnych klawiszy. | |
| 523_CustomProcessKeySample_1_03_Ja | To przykład dostosowania procesu naciśnięcia klawiszy do wykonywania różnych naciśnięć klawiszy. Możesz wykonywać skróty takie jak "Cofnij", "Powtórz", "Zaznacz wszystko" czy "Otwórz Eksploratora", a także wprowadzać wiele znaków, takich jak emotikony, jednocześnie. | |
| 524_SpecialKeySample_1_03_Ja | Przykład z tonacją molową zdefiniowaną jako tonacja, ale rzadko używaną. To po prostu zbiór zdefiniowanych rzeczy, więc mogą zdarzyć się rzeczy, które nie dzieją się po naciśnięciu klawisza. Niektóre mogą zachowywać się inaczej w zależności od systemu operacyjnego i preferencji. | |
| 531_KeyExtendDecorateSample_1_03_Ja | To jest próbka z szczegółowymi dekoracjami nałożonymi na klawisze. Możesz ustawić różne ustawienia, takie jak "display text", "font", "colour text", "color of text", "color of background", "background image" oraz "border". | |
| 532_KeyImeDecorateSample_1_03_Ja | Jest to przykład, w którym dekoracja klucza zmienia się w zależności od stanu IME. Litery wprowadzane po naciśnięciu klawiszy mogą być rozpoznawane przez stan IME. | |
| 533_KeyPressDecorateSample_1_03_Ja | Jest to próbka, w której dekoracja klawisza zmienia się w zależności od stanu nacisku określonego klawisza. Na przykład naciśnij klawisze Shift lub Ctrl, aby zmienić tekst powyżej. | |
| 534_KeyLockDecorateSample_1_03_Ja | To przykład uzyskania stanu przełącznika klucza zarządzanego przez Windows, takiego jak CapsLock i Insert, oraz zmiany projektu klucza. |